Emerging from Dunn's ambitious citizen science project 'Your Wild Life' (an initiative based at North Carolina State University), Dr. Eleanor's Book of Common Ants of New York City provides an eye-opening entomological overview of the natural history of New York's species most noted by project participants and even offers insight into the ant denizens of the city's subways and Central Park. Exploring species from the honeyrump ant to the Japanese crazy ant, and featuring Wild's stunning photography as well as tips on keeping ant farms in your home, this guide will be a tremendous resource for teachers, students, and scientists alike..
